ACLS, BLS Where You'll Work About CHI St. Alexius Health CHI St.
Alexius Health is a Level II Trauma Center and is the largest
health care delivery system in central and western North Dakota
that is comprised of a tertiary hospital in Bismarck and critical
access hospitals (CAHs) in Carrington, Dickinson, Devils Lake,
Garrison, Turtle Lake, Washburn and Williston and numerous clinics
and outpatient services. In addition, CHI St. Alexius Health
manages five CAHs in North Dakota- Ashley, Elgin, Linton, and
Wishek, as well as Mobridge Regional Medical Center in Mobridge,
SD. CHI St. Alexius Health – Bismarck, is a 185-bed, full-service,
acute care medical center offering a full line of inpatient and
outpatient medical services, including primary and specialty
physician clinics; home health and hospice services; durable
medical equipment services and a fitness and human performance
center. Since our founding in 1885, CHI St. Alexius Health has been
dedicated to serving the residents of central and western North
Dakota, northern South Dakota and eastern Montana. CHI St. Alexius
Health is a Roman Catholic organization whose sponsors are the
Sisters of St. Benedict of the Annunciation Monastery, in Bismarck,
ND and as an organization, we follow the Ethical and Religious
Directives for Catholic Health Care Services as promulgated by the
United States Conference of Catholic Bishops. CHI St. Alexius
